White Mountaineering and Porter Collaborate on a New Belt Capsule
The two brands move from bags to belts.


The latest release in White Mountaineering‘s ongoing collaboration with Porter sees the two brands move away from bags and on to belts. The new accessories come in four different colorways, with black and burgundy as well as green and navy options all available, with each being made from patent leather. Both White Mountaineering and Porter’s details are embossed on to the inside of the belt, along with the “MADE IN JAPAN” certification. There’s no official release date for the collaboration yet, but each belt is set to cost ¥23,000 JPY, roughly $210 USD.
